WILLAMSON
AND BELL INTO RECORD BOOKS
Friday August 17th, 22:45 NZT
Aging
snipers Needles Williamson and Ian Bell lead the Rink
Rats with six points each in the slaughter (13-2) of the three-legged
horse, otherwise known as the hapless Mustangs.
In the fourth and final meeting of the regular season, the Rats
stretched their record out to 4-0-0, out-scored the opposition by
33-10, and enjoyed a 20.0% (3 from 15) power-play unit. The penalty-kill
unit finished the season against the Donkeys unbeaten (0 from 9),
and the team posted a 56 shots-on advantage (121-65).
Williamson
and Bell move into a tie with 1999 legend Nathan Pugh and
captain Louis Tremblay for first place in the most points
scored by a player in a single game.
